Output 650762621d5640421e5e9c968f500f78c2d84ff1f70eb1e4b3081bdf94bf020f:1

value
1950460
script pubkey
OP_0 OP_PUSHBYTES_20 6d7c8361fa69cf110876b5821a214fc0638372fa
address
ltc1qd47gxc06d883zzrkkkpp5g20cp3cxuh6z35uan
transaction
650762621d5640421e5e9c968f500f78c2d84ff1f70eb1e4b3081bdf94bf020f
spent
true